8
Views
2
Comments
Extensibility Configurations in life time failed for mobile app icon
Application Type
Mobile
Service Studio Version
11.8.1 (Build 24074)
Platform Version
11.8.1 (Build 15399)

I am working for generating custom mobile app icons for different environment by overriding the Extensibility Configurations json  data for the app icon in the life time settings.

The app icon generation is successful (android/iphone) when I configured  json in home module of the mobile application. But when i tried to put the same json in the life time custom configuration it  is throwing error.

"Failed to deserialize JSON to REST_ErrorRecord:

The uploaded json data is valid and the problem arises only if add "icons" tag

Unexpected character encountered while parsing value: <. Path '', line 0, position 0."

Life time version - > 

11.6.0 (Build 506)


AppIcon.json

Hi Sabeeb,

I had the same error. After reporting to OutSystems they referred to it as a bug in Lifetime. That happens when the json is bigger than a certain number of chars. 

To "fix" that error, I minimized the JSON using jsonminifier. Most of the times it worked. Newer versions of Lifetime have that bug fixed.


Cheers,

António Pereira